Lawn care services typically involve a range of maintenance tasks designed to keep residential and commercial properties looking their best. These services often include mowing, edging, trimming, and fertilizing to promote healthy, lush grass growth. Some providers also handle weed control, aeration, and overseeding to improve the overall appearance and health of the lawn. Regular lawn care helps prevent issues like patchy grass, overgrowth, and soil compaction, making outdoor spaces more enjoyable and easier to maintain between visits.

Many property owners turn to professional lawn care to address common problems such as uneven growth, pest infestations, and weed encroachment. Overgrown lawns can quickly become unmanageable, especially during peak growing seasons, leading to an unkempt appearance. Additionally, unmanaged weeds can spread rapidly, choking out desirable plants and grass. Lawn care specialists can identify underlying issues and implement targeted solutions to restore the health and beauty of outdoor spaces, saving homeowners time and effort.

The overview below groups typical Lawn Care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Marion County, TN.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or lawn care repairs, such as fixing sprinkler heads or patching small bare spots, generally range from $50 to $200. Many routine maintenance jobs fall within this range, depending on the scope of work.

Basic Lawn Maintenance - Regular services like mowing, edging, and trimming usually cost between $250 and $600 for many residential properties. Most projects of this size tend to stay within this middle tier, with fewer reaching higher amounts.

Landscape Enhancements - Installing new flower beds, planting shrubs, or adding mulch can cost from $600 to $2,500, depending on the size and complexity of the project. Larger, more detailed landscape improvements can exceed this range, but many projects stay within the lower to mid-level budgets.

Full Lawn Replacement - Complete overhaul or re-sodding of a lawn often ranges from $3,000 to $8,000 or more, especially for larger yards or complex designs. These projects are less common and tend to push into higher cost brackets due to the scale of work involved.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When comparing lawn care service providers in Marion County, TN, it's important to consider their experience with similar projects. Homeowners should seek out local contractors who have a proven track record of handling lawn care tasks comparable to their specific needs. This can include understanding the types of grass, soil conditions, and landscaping features common in the area. Asking about the length of time a service provider has been working in the community or the scope of projects they have completed can help gauge their familiarity with local conditions and challenges.

Clear, written expectations are crucial when evaluating potential service providers. Homeowners should look for contractors who can provide detailed descriptions of their services, including what is included and what is not. Having this information in writing helps prevent misunderstandings and ensures everyone is aligned on the scope of work. It’s also helpful to inquire whether the provider offers written estimates or proposals, which can serve as a reference point throughout the project.

Reputable references and good communication are key indicators of a reliable lawn care service. Homeowners should ask local contractors for references from previous clients with similar lawn care needs. Speaking directly with past customers can provide insights into the quality of work, reliability, and professionalism. Additionally, effective communication-whether through prompt responses, clarity in explanations, or willingness to answer questions-can make the process smoother and more transparent.
